The parents of the conjoined twins, Angie and Azzedine Benhaffaf, said yesterday that their baby sons had won the “battle of their lives” after they were successfully separated.
Like so many other Irish children, they owe a debt to the surgeons and the gifted team at Great Ormond Street Hospital, in London. About 20 staff, including four anaesthetists and four surgeons, contributed to the complex procedure. They and the babies’ parents represent much that is good and admirable about the human spirit.
